TICKET: Vault locked — Crumbport order-cutoff rule

The Crumbport bakery platform enforces a 6 p.m. order cutoff via a scheduled job that reads signing material from the Ovenlatch vault. During last night's run the vault sealed itself after three failed unseal attempts, so the cutoff job could not sign the nightly order manifest and tomorrow's wholesale orders are blocked. Standard unseal through the operator console is unavailable while the audit hold is active. For the security reviewer: the emergency recovery passphrase follows below.

recovery phrase for hafop-kadup: quenath-fendor

## Tuning

Slimtainer strips layers, dedupes shared libs, and prunes locale data before publishing. Plugin authors: your hooks run inside the prune pass, so respect the size and time budgets or the build aborts. Defaults suit typical Varnholt registry images; override per-plugin via the manifest, not at runtime. Aggressive settings can strip files your plugin needs — test against the sample images first. The default tuning constants are given below.

limits module of fajog-tawig:
RATE_LIMITS = {
    "druwyn": 2,
    "quenael": 10,
    "wenix": 2,
    "druael": 2,
}

## Digestron Environments

Quick orientation for on-call: we run three environments — dev, staging, and prod — and only prod actually sends email digests to real recipients. Staging points at the sink mailbox, so don't panic if queue depth spikes there overnight; the batcher drains it at 06:00. The scheduler cron lives in the service config, not in the orchestrator, which trips people up constantly. If digests are late, check the batch window first. Prod currently runs with the following values.

config for kafof-bawef:
holath:
  log_level: debug
  metrics_host: metrics.holath.qorvelsys.internal
  pin: 2191
  pool_size: 32

## Artifact Signing — Order Cutoff Rule

The Ovenlight cutoff service locks bakery orders at 16:00 daily. The cutoff ruleset ships as a signed artifact; unsigned rulesets are ignored by the scheduler. Build with `cutoff-pack`, sign, then push to the Flourline registry. Signing is mandatory, no exceptions. Use the deploy key below for your local signing setup.

release key, hadug-kawef: bky13_mPGeFZeR1GZ1G